Personal data Lea Isaac Boas 


Household of Lea Isaac Boas

She is married to Levy Joseph.

Permission for the marriage has been obtained in Amsterdam (NH) on January 5, 1798.Source 1

They got married in the year 1798 at Amsterdam (NH), she was 22 years old.
